Action item: The Relayn deploy-status bot silently dropped updates when the pipeline API paginated results, so responders believed a rollback had completed when it had not. We will add pagination handling, a staleness banner, and an integration test. Until merged, verify deploy state directly in the pipeline console, documented at the page below.

runbook for kahop-kajop: https://rundeck.ordinio.test/display/secrets/pipeline/issue/pages/repo/browse/e5732776e07d1285107e5aeb

For new folks: the user module (auth, profiles, preferences) currently lives inside the Coppermine monolith and shares tables with billing. This ticket tracks carving it into a standalone service behind the existing gateway. Phase one moves profile reads to the new service with dual-writes; phase two cuts over auth. Migration scripts live in the userland-split repo. Nothing ships until the shadow-traffic comparison shows under 0.1% divergence for a full week. Current shadow results were captured on the build below:

session token of yajof-bagef = htk4_937d

Subject: Soft deletes in the orders table — read this first

Hey, welcome to the rotation! Quick heads-up before your first shift: the `orders` table in Marblecart never hard-deletes rows. Anything "deleted" just gets a `retired_at` timestamp, so plugin authors querying it directly will see ghosts unless they filter those out. If a partner reports duplicate or phantom orders, that filter is almost always the culprit. Don't run cleanup scripts yourself — ever. The full soft-delete policy and the approved query patterns are written up here.

wiki page, bawef-hafop: https://jira.nelvroworks.corp/job/pages/projects/7c5c0f440dbd

# Hey, welcome aboard! This module drives bulk edits in the Quillbarn admin
# table — select rows, pick an action, and we batch the updates server-side.
# Batches that are too big time out on slow shards, and too-small ones hammer
# the queue. The values below came from trial and error, so tweak carefully.
# The current tuning constants are as follows.

tuning table, yajog-yahof:
BUDGETS = {
    "lamvan": 303,
    "wenox": 460,
    "fenvan": 525,
}